First up, let's talk *breathing*. It might sound basic, but proper breath control is the *key* to powerful and sustainable voice acting. Think of your breath as the fuel that powers your vocal engine. Without a good fuel supply, your engine sputters and stalls. Actors often neglect this part of the craft, but if your breath isn't controlled then you will struggle to hit those notes, project your voice, and maintain consistency throughout your performance. Try this: diaphragmatic breathing. Place one hand on your chest and the other on your stomach. As you inhale, focus on expanding your stomach while keeping your chest relatively still. This ensures you're breathing deeply from your diaphragm, which provides more support for your voice. Practice inhaling slowly for four counts, holding for four counts, and exhaling slowly for four counts. Repeat this several times, focusing on the feeling of your diaphragm expanding and contracting. As you become more comfortable, you can increase the duration of each phase. This exercise not only improves your breath control but also helps to calm your nerves and center your focus before a recording session. Think of it as meditation for your voice, preparing you mentally and physically for the task ahead. Remember, a well-supported voice is a strong voice, capable of delivering captivating performances that resonate with your audience.
